Feeds and Nutrition
Second Edition by M.E. Ensminger et al
This comprehensive book, now in its second edition, is a hands-on guide to the nutritional
feeding of domestic animals. It will be of immense value to agricultural professionals and students,
as well as to those in the business of animal food production and processing.
Features
- In-depth coverage of animal nutrition
- Feeds treated thoroughly, including supplements, processing, crop residues, evaluation, and more
- Feeding of each animal species covered separately, and quite extensively
- Color and black/white photographs, flowcharts, diagrams, graphs, and tables are provided to
well-illustrate this practical reference
